How do you assess the quality and meaning of data for reporting and analytics?

Sample answer to the question

To assess the quality and meaning of data for reporting and analytics, I start by understanding the data sources and collection methods. I check if the data is accurate, complete, and reliable. I also examine the data structure and determine if it aligns with the defined business requirements. Next, I analyze the data using statistical techniques and look for any outliers or inconsistencies. I ensure that the data is relevant to the reporting and analytics goals. Finally, I validate the data by comparing it with external sources or conducting data integrity tests. By following these steps, I can ensure that the data used for reporting and analytics is of high quality and provides meaningful insights.

A more solid answer

To assess the quality and meaning of data for reporting and analytics, I employ a systematic approach. First, I thoroughly understand the data sources, collection methods, and business requirements to ensure alignment. Then, I perform data profiling to identify anomalies and inconsistencies, using statistical techniques like mean, median, and standard deviation. I also leverage data visualization tools like Tableau to gain additional insights. To validate the data, I conduct data integrity tests and compare it with external sources or benchmarks. Lastly, I communicate the findings and insights to stakeholders in a clear and concise manner, using visualizations and reports. This comprehensive approach ensures that the data used for reporting and analytics is of high quality and provides meaningful insights for decision-making.

Why this is a more solid answer:

The solid answer provides a more detailed and systematic approach to assessing data quality and meaning. It highlights the use of statistical techniques and data visualization tools like Tableau, which are essential for effective data analysis. It also emphasizes the importance of aligning data with business requirements and effectively communicating the findings to stakeholders. However, it could further improve by providing specific examples of statistical techniques or data integrity tests employed in the assessment process.

An exceptional answer

Assessing the quality and meaning of data for reporting and analytics requires a multifaceted approach. Firstly, I collaborate closely with stakeholders to understand their reporting needs and business requirements. This ensures that the data collected aligns with the intended purpose. Secondly, I employ various statistical analysis techniques, such as regression analysis or hypothesis testing, to uncover patterns, relationships, and insights within the data. Additionally, I leverage automated data validation and cleansing techniques, such as data profiling and outlier detection, to ensure data accuracy and reliability. To enhance data meaning, I use data visualization tools like Tableau to create interactive dashboards and reports that effectively communicate the insights to stakeholders. Finally, I continuously monitor and improve the data quality by implementing data governance processes and conducting regular data audits. This comprehensive approach enables me to provide high-quality and meaningful data for reporting and analytics.

Why this is an exceptional answer:

The exceptional answer demonstrates a deep understanding of data assessment methodologies, statistical analysis techniques, and the use of data visualization tools like Tableau. It also highlights the importance of collaborating with stakeholders to ensure data alignment with business requirements. The answer goes beyond the basic and solid answers by introducing advanced statistical analysis techniques like regression analysis and hypothesis testing. It also emphasizes the importance of automated data validation and data governance processes for ongoing data quality improvement. Overall, the exceptional answer showcases a comprehensive and advanced approach to assessing data quality and meaning for reporting and analytics.

How to prepare for this question

  • Familiarize yourself with popular data analysis and visualization tools like Tableau and Power BI.
  • Develop a solid understanding of statistical analysis techniques and their applications in data assessment.
  • Practice using data profiling techniques to identify outliers and inconsistencies in datasets.
  • Enhance your communication skills to effectively communicate the findings and insights to stakeholders.
  • Stay updated with the latest trends and advancements in data analytics and business intelligence.
